In this episode, Mangtas Nation had an in-depth discussion with Supply Chain Management Professor, Dr. Justin Goldston. He talks about the basics of Blockchain, AI, Web 3.0, Metaverse, and Agile Method. Being a Sustainability enthusiast, Dr. Justin has also provided insightful opinions and advice about creating sustainable change with technology as well as shared the findings and theories of his research projects.
Dr. Justin is a Professor at Penn State University, a Web3 Systems Thinker, Metaverse Builder, TEDx Speaker, author, and a Supply Chain and Sustainability Enthusiast.
